Transaction 151eb59e227c413c49543e95619a90798f7db9f58a7d4dbf0247da7c75b93fdf

1 Input
2 Outputs
  • 151eb59e227c413c49543e95619a90798f7db9f58a7d4dbf0247da7c75b93fdf:0
  • value  180990
    address  1DNPsFsa9gx5djN93VYNYARrgsCTmHhj7G
  • 151eb59e227c413c49543e95619a90798f7db9f58a7d4dbf0247da7c75b93fdf:1
  • value  14584000
    address  3CxV2bZo9mksxcFgo7pMuegncVE9mjaYna